If this squeaking is from the right rear I want you to take off your right wheel. Use the scissors jack to jack up the car at the point under the car where you are supposed to. Now put a hydrolic jack under the radius arm knuckle. Jack it up and down and tell me if you hear the noise.
1)Does it go away when it rains?
2)Do you hear it over rough pavement?
If you answer to all 2 (really 3) then look at the bracket that holds the sway bar pivot bushing and muffler hangar. The triangular one. There is a possibility that it is broken. I took all of my rear suspension apart trying to track it down and found nothing. Then the other day I was checking my brakes and I said..."What the hell is that noise?". Looked up and sure nuff it was cracked. I squirted some lube oil in there and the noise went away for a day or two.
If it is that bracket, it is a $10.00 part from the dealer. I amputting my new one on tomorrow. It also makes the rear of the car handle very sloppy.
